
Ergosanté, the leading French company in the design and production of passive exoskeletons, is changing the name of its flagship product "HAPO MS". From now on, the exoskeleton will be known as "HAPO FRONT". The name change is accompanied by a new logo and visual identity. In addition, the exoskeleton will be interchangeable with its new product, the "HAPO UP", sold as the "HAPO UP-FRONT" kit.
A strategic, future-oriented change
The new name was chosen to emphasize the exoskeleton's core functionality. The exoskeleton relieves the load on the upper part of the body when working at mid-height. This is made possible by the exoskeleton's lightweight, flexible design. Thanks to these qualities, workers can move around easily while wearing the device.
The name change is also part of a more general trend towards thegrowing use of exoskeletons in the workplace. Indeed, employers increasingly see these devices as a solution for improving workers' health, safety and well-being. They also increase efficiency and productivity.
The new "HAPO Front" exoskeleton helps workers perform repetitive or physically demanding tasks. It provides postural support and helps reduce work-related muscle and joint pain. Thanks to its design, it reduces the load on upper limbs, shoulders and elbows when working with arms out in front. Its permanent support enables workers to accomplish their tasks more easily and efficiently.
